Barbecued squid, lime and chilli salad

Ingredients

  • zest and juice 1 lime, plus
  • 2 extra, halved
  • ¼ cup extra-vir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ons white wine
  • 1 eschalot, finely chopped
  • 1 garlic clove, finely chopped
  • 1 fresh bay leaf
  • 600g cleaned squid tubes, scored, cut into 2cm strips
  • 4 long red chillies
  • 1 bunch rocket leaves, washed, trimmed
  • ½ teaspoon cumin seeds, toasted

Preparation method

  1. In a small bowl combine zest, juice, 1 tablespoon oil, wine, eschalot, garlic and bay leaf. Add squid, tossing to combine. Cover and chill for at least
    20 minutes to marinate.

  2. Meanwhile, heat an oiled barbecue plate or char-grill pan on high. Cook chillies 2-3 minutes each side, until charred all over. Seal in a small plastic bag and set aside 5 minutes, then peel away skins. Slice in half lengthways and scrape out seeds. Slice flesh into strips.

  3. Drain squid. Char-grill 2-3 minutes, turning with tongs until curled and opaque. Grill extra limes, cut side down, 2-3 minutes until charred on surface.

  4. In a bowl, toss squid, chillies, rocket and remaining oil together. Season to taste. Sprinkle with seeds and serve with grilled lime halves.
